Embodiment approach 1
[0072] pass figure 2 An example of the cross-sectional structure of the optical cable according to the present disclosure will be described. exist figure 2Among them, 11 is the cable core, 12 is the inner sheath, 13 is the metal sheath, 14 is the outer sheath, and 15 is the outer sheath tear line. The cable core 11 is arranged at the center of the optical cable and gathers a plurality of optical fibers. The inner sheath 12 is disposed on the outer periphery of the cable core 11 and covers the cable core 11 . The inner jacket 12 may have a tension member that protects the optical fiber against tension applied to the cable. Examples of the material of the inner sheath 12 include polyethylene, flame-retardant polyethylene, polyvinyl chloride, and the like. The cable core 11 and the inner sheath 12 are collectively referred to as a cable body. Embodiment approach 2
[0076] pass image 3 An example of the cross-sectional structure of the optical cable according to the present disclosure will be described. exist image 3 Among them, 11 is the cable core, 12 is the inner sheath, 13 is the metal sheath, 14 is the outer sheath, and 15 is the outer sheath tear line. The outer sheath tear line 15 may be at least partially embedded in the outer peripheral surface of the inner sheath 12 . That is, a part of the outer sheath tear line 15 may be embedded in the inner sheath 12 and a part may be exposed from the inner sheath 12 , or the entire outer sheath tear line 15 may be embedded in the inner sheath 12 . like image 3 As shown, partially embedded means that a part of the tear line 15 of the outer sheath is embedded in the inner sheath 12 in a cross section perpendicular to the longitudinal direction of the optical cable.

Embodiment approach 3
[0079] pass Figure 4 An example of the cross-sectional structure of the optical cable according to the present disclosure will be described. exist Figure 4 Among them, 11 is the cable core, 12 is the inner sheath, 13 is the metal sheath, 14 is the outer sheath, 15 is the tear line of the outer sheath, and 16 is the tear line of the inner sheath. The optical cable of the present disclosure includes at least one inner jacket tear line 16 disposed along the length direction inside the layer of the inner jacket 12 and tearing the inner jacket 12 .
[0080] Figure 4 The optical cable shown is an example in which the inner sheath tear line 16 is further provided in addition to the optical cable described in the first embodiment. It is only necessary to have at least one inner sheath tear line 16, or there may be a plurality of them. By having the inner sheath tear line 16, the inner sheath 12 can be easily torn.
